The Start Tracks



The Start Reading Track

Start Reading is essentially the activity that many parents do with their children at bedtime: reading and re-reading. We do it a little more scientifically however. We choose the books carefully. We want to provide concentrated experience of books so that pupils move move towards picking up repeated phrases and joining in spontaneously with our reading.

We don't expect pupils to read these books in the traditional sense, though we move seamlessly to the point at which they can start DIY Reading.



The Start Reading Words Track

The objective of the Start Reading Words track is to teach the pupil to blend sounds. Pupils practise blending using cards with 3 letter words (consonant, vowel, consonant). The cards are ordered so that pupils develop the skills that during our research were shown to be useful steps to blending.

As in any track, this is assessment through teaching, and therefore at each session the teacher is sensitive to changes in the pupil's response that indicate the need to move to a different stage.



The Start Spelling Track

The Start Spelling Track gives the pupil the spelling vocabulary that allows them to start Write Words.

We teach pupils to write a series of personalised sentences. We use techniques that prevent pupils from becoming overloaded by new information and that make sure that information is retained in long-term memory. As we do this we model the identification of sound segments in words.

Start Spelling can be carried out with pupils working individually in a group setting.



The Start Writing Track

Start Writing is the foundation for DIY Writing. It mirrors Start Reading in that it is a process of joint writing. As with Start Spelling, we're modelling the identification of sound segments. Start Writing can be carried out with pupils in a group.







Start Tracks are usually run in groups of two or occasionally, individually.

They are used to lay the foundations for reading very easy books independently, blending and spelling 20 words.

Pupils can then start the core tracks:

DIY Reading
Read Words
Write Words
Chunks and Rules

The core tracks are usually delivered in groups of 4-6 pupils.
